WebBased on these sites, there are three phases of digestive regulation: 1.The cephalic phase comprises those stimuli that originate from the head: sight, smell, taste, or thoughts of food, as well as emotional states. In response, the following reflexes are initiated: Neural response: Stimuli that arouse digestion are relayed to the hypothalamus ... WebJun 4, 2013 · Structure. There are four main regions in the stomach: the cardia, fundus, body, and pylorus (Figure 1).The cardia (or cardiac region) is the point where the esophagus connects to the stomach and through which food passes into the stomach. Located inferior to the diaphragm, above and to the left of the cardia, is the dome-shaped … WebDigestive Phases. The response to food begins even before food enters the mouth. WebJan 25, 2024 · Regulation of Digestion. The entire digestion process involves six main steps: ingestion, propulsion (swallowing and movement of food through the alimentary canal), mechanical or physical digestion, chemical digestion, absorption, and excretion. Each step of digestion is under neural and hormonal regulation. WebAug 21, 2016 · The stomach is a muscular hollow organ. It takes in food from the esophagus (gullet or food pipe), mixes it, breaks it down, and then passes it on to the small intestine in small portions. Digestion of food is a form of catabolism, in which the food is broken down into small molecules that the body can absorb and use for energy, growth, and repair.Digestion occurs when food is moved through the digestive system. It begins in the mouth and ends in the small intestine. The final products of digestion are absorbed from … tampa to clewiston flWebDigestive Processes. The processes of digestion include six activities: ingestion, propulsion, mechanical or physical digestion, chemical digestion, absorption, and defecation. The first of these processes, ingestion, refers to the entry of food into the alimentary canal through the mouth.
